Jiří Polášek
c8da70d6fa CmdPal: Replace assembly metadata attributes with preprocessor directives (#44707)
## Summary of the Pull Request

This PR replaces custom metadata attributes used to pass build-time
information with preprocessor directives. It appears that metadata can
be stripped from the final build output, even though it survived AOT in
earlier tests on the main and stable branches.

New preprocesor directives in Microsoft.CmdPal.UI:
- `BUILD_INFO_PUBLISH_AOT` - when `PublishAot` MSBuild parameter is
`true`
- `BUILD_INFO_PUBLISH_TRIMMED `- when `PublishTrimmed` MSBuild parameter
is `true`
- `BUILD_INFO_CIBUILD `- when `CIBuild` MSBuild parameter is `true`

Using preprocessor directives avoids this uncertainty and provides a
more reliable solution.

74448355f9 Peek: Show error message when activated in unsupported virtual folders (#44703)
<!-- Enter a brief description/summary of your PR here. What does it
fix/what does it change/how was it tested (even manually, if necessary)?
-->
## Summary of the Pull Request

When Peek is activated in virtual folders like Home or Recent, it now
displays a clear error message instead of showing a stuck loading state
or "Search in Microsoft Store" link.

### Problem
When users activate Peek (press the hotkey) in Windows virtual folders
such as Home or Recent, the Shell API (SVGIO_SELECTION) returns 0 items
because these folders don't support the standard file selection
retrieval mechanism. Previously, this caused:

- The Peek window to appear stuck in a loading state
- The "Search in Microsoft Store" fallback UI to display incorrectly
- Subsequent Peek activations to fail until the window was manually
closed

### Solution

- Added a check in `Initialize()` to detect when no files are found
after querying the Shell
- Display an error InfoBar with a user-friendly message: "No files
selected or this folder is not supported for preview."
- Hide the `FilePreview` control when the error is shown to prevent
displaying irrelevant fallback UI
- Close the window automatically when the user dismisses the InfoBar
(clicks X)

8b79da5d49 Fix Image Resizer doesn’t work when using the UI. (#44687)
<!-- Enter a brief description/summary of your PR here. What does it
fix/what does it change/how was it tested (even manually, if necessary)?
-->
## Summary of the Pull Request
1. Update the CLI Log Folder
2. Fixes an `ArgumentOutOfRangeException` that occurs in ImageResizer
when the `CustomSize` or `AiSize` properties change.

Changed the collection changed notification from `Replace` to `Reset`
for both `CustomSize` and `AiSize` property changes. While `Reset` is
less efficient (it forces a full UI refresh rather than updating a
single item), it avoids the index validation issue since it doesn't
require specifying an index.
